Transaction e56c75d16870dc4cea8897240db07a4faed350968ee2afe6940507ae8c652b75

block
5d82b523400f39a22b7c14cd88b2e4f3b1e850e20a006334c4267cd26e3ed4c2

16 Inputs

2 Outputs